Transaction 57dac72bd3e466340e201c36ce7a23001b56e6d0037973910e9099b4dbc35e2c
1 Input
1 Output
-
57dac72bd3e466340e201c36ce7a23001b56e6d0037973910e9099b4dbc35e2c:0
- value
- 129605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8368620f103808040130f57f0590499a0d9aea2 OP_EQUAL
- address
- 3Nrr1SNKJA78KzZyRCyLATwuE3xQVnujZS